Published in 2002 by Wiley-IEEE Press, Power System Economics was, and remains, the "first systematic presentation of electricity market design—from the basics to the cutting edge". At the time of its publication, the global push to deregulate and restructure electricity industries was in full swing, and a great deal of confusion existed among market designers. Stoft’s book cut through this chaos by providing a pragmatic, lucid framework focused entirely on fundamentals and using dozens of real-world examples.

One of the most heavily studied sections of the book involves pricing mechanisms. Stoft provides a masterclass on how Locational Marginal Pricing (LMP) works. LMP calculates the cost of supplying the next megawatt of energy at a specific location on the grid, accounting for both the cost of generation and the physical limitations (congestion and losses) of the transmission lines. 3.
